I have had a seventy gallon reef aquarium, up for about four years now. Through all my trials and tribulations I have yet to rid my aquarium of hair algae. I am contemplating adding some type of extreme bio filtration upgrade. Maybe the ROCKER. My question is what is my likelihood of success? Or is scrubbing my rocks ,one by one, every five or six months the best I can expect.

Bio filtration will just add to your problem, the protein skimmer if adequate should be enough. I found that controlling your nitrates and adding enough turbo snails will do the trick.
